探索iOS移动应用开发的技巧与挑战
文章:
随着智能手机的普及和移动应用市场的蓬勃发展,iOS移动应用开发成为了一个备受关注的领域。无论是开发者还是用户,都对iOS平台上的应用充满了期待和需求。本文将探讨iOS移动应用开发的技巧与挑战,帮助读者更好地理解这个领域并为其提供一些有用的指导。
首先,要成为一名出色的iOS移动应用开发者,我们需要掌握一些关键的技巧。首要之处是熟悉Swift编程语言,它是iOS应用开发的主要语言。Swift具有简洁、安全、高效等特点,可以帮助我们开发出稳定而优质的应用。另外,我们还需要了解iOS开发框架和工具,如UIKit、Core Data、Xcode等,它们提供了丰富的功能和工具,可以简化开发过程并提高开发效率。
其次,iOS移动应用开发也面临着一些挑战。一个重要的挑战是不断变化的技术和平台要求。随着iOS版本的更新和新技术的出现,开发者需要不断学习和适应新的技术和工具。此外,iOS设备的多样性也是一个挑战。开发者需要在不同的设备上进行测试和适配,以确保应用在各种设备上都能够正常运行并提供良好的用户体验。
除了技巧和挑战,iOS移动应用开发还有许多值得关注的方面。其中之一是用户体验设计。在开发应用时,我们需要注重用户体验,使应用界面简洁、直观、易用,并提供丰富的功能和良好的反馈机制。此外,安全性也是一个重要的考虑因素。我们需要确保应用的数据传输和存储安全,以防止用户信息泄露或应用被恶意攻击。
在iOS移动应用开发中,测试和调试也是不可或缺的环节。我们需要进行全面的测试,包括功能测试、性能测试、用户界面测试等,以确保应用的质量和稳定性。此外,及时修复bug和进行性能优化也是必要的步骤,以提供更好的用户体验。